    love this. How do you keep your fingerprints from the resin as you are pressing it down? Also, everything I have made with alcohol ink has faded, do you have this problem?

    • @fairyspunfibers9098
      @fairyspunfibers9098 2 роки тому +1

      @Anne M
      What brand alcohol ink are you using? Some are of such poor quality that they would fade, even if you keep the objects in a black bag! I use Let's Resin alcohol inks. I can't speak to any other brand, as far as light-fastness goes.
      Also, the quality of resin you use can also make a huge difference. I use 3 different resins, all high quality: Platinum 360+, JDiction 3X UV-Protection, and Let's Resin (Daniel Cooper's formula). All are 2-part epoxies. All of them seem to preserve my Let's Resin alcohol ink colors. Mr. Cooper made 2 sets of cabochon using Let's Resin inks. One set he left outside in full sun (during England's hottest Summer in memory) about 12 to 16 weeks. The other set was kept in a dark pouch inside a drawer. The outdoor set hardly differs at all from the indoor set. Don't know if that helps, though?
      No resin, glass, acrylic, or any other reflective surface should be kept where direct sunlight can strike the surface, if only because of the risk of fire, never mind yellowing, fading, or cracking.
